A Line of Credit refers to the maximum borrowing power that a lender extends to a borrower. The borrower may draw required amounts from the fixed amount. Usually, it is a credit source extended to any credit-worthy business by a bank or any financial institution. A line of credit includes cash credit, overdraft, demand loan, export packing credit, term loan, discounting or purchase of commercial bills, etc. The borrower may use the line of credit to overcome liquidity problems. Requisite amounts may be withdrawn from the account as and when required. The borrower pays interest only for the amount withdrawn.

A Hawaii Line of Credit Promissory Note can become unenforceable due to various factors. If the note lacks essential elements, such as clear terms or signatures, it may not hold up. Additionally, if one party did not have the legal capacity to enter into a contract, that could void the agreement. It is crucial to ensure that all components are properly executed to maintain enforceability.

If you lose the original Hawaii Line of Credit Promissory Note, it can be concerning, but solutions exist. You should notify your lender immediately, as they may require you to sign an affidavit or go through a formal process to replace it. Keeping the lender informed ensures that your obligations are still recognized, even without the original document.
